Introduction
Thank you on purchasing the Fysic F10 telephone. This easy to use mobile phone for
seniors is hearing aid compatible and suitable for 4G mobile network. It offers many
functions such as a SOS alarm button which sends SMS with SOS message to
emergency numbers or calls emergency numbers in handsfree mode.
The font size on the color LCD display is large and the buttons on the button pad are
easy to see and use with big buttons, speed dial buttons, call volume amplification,
zoom function, built-in flashlight, long stand-by and operating time, calendar, calculator,
camera, video, FM-Radio, phonebook, speakerphone, speed dial buttons and no SIM-
lock . It is important that you read the instructions below in order to use your Fysic F10
telephone to its full potential. Keep this user guide in a safe place for future reference.

Installation
IMPORTANT
Turn off the phone and disconnect the charger before removing the battery cover.
Installing the SD card
Insert the memory card into the slot under the SIM card holder, make sure the card faces
downwards. Do not scratch or bend the card. The SD card is used as a phone storage.
When connect to a computer by a USB cable you can copy data such as music, contacts,
pictures,…

8
Installing the SIM card
1. Insert the SIM card into the SIM card slot upon the memory card holder.
(Make sure the card is facing inwards.)
2. First, turn off the phone before taking out the SIM card.
Installing the battery
When you use the phone for the first time, charge the battery for 4 hours to achieve the
best state of the battery. Remove the battery cover, insert the battery into the battery
compartment and replace the cover.

Menu
When in standby mode, you can choose by the Left-selection button “Menu”
different options by scrolling the buttons and you can choose the options
“Phonebook”, “Message”, “Call logs”, “Alarm”, “Camera”, “Magnifier”,
“Recorder”, “Organiser”, “Multimedia”, “Settings”. The chapters below explain each
section in detail.
Phonebook
When you enter the menu Phonebook you can immediately start adding contacts or by
pressing the Left-selection button you can choose Options where you can find:
“New”, “Photo contact”, “Delete multiple”, “Import/Export”, “Others”.
You can enter these options by scrolling and select with the Left-selection button
to choose the required option.
Note: You can enter the menu “Phonebook” by pressing the Right-section button/Back
button or the Left-selection button and choose the icon “Phonebook”.
